    Default Line display

    We establish line weight by color but I prefer to draw in B&W. Is there a way do do this?

    Default Re: Line display

    Not sure I understand the question or the conditions. Are you saying that you use color-dependent plot styles which have the lineweight set in the plot style, or are you setting the lineweight in the drawing file, but have a strict mapping of assigned colors and corresponding lineweights?

    Is your plotted output in color or in black and white? If your plots are black and white, you could set up a viewport on a layout tab and check the Display plot styles toggle to see all of the linework in the plotted color. That will be about as close to editing in black and white if you are relying on object color to determine the lineweight.
